About East Ventures
East Ventures is a venture capital firm founded in 2009. It is primarily based out of Tokyo, Japan. As of Aug 2026, East Ventures is an active investor, having invested in 526 companies, with 16 new investments in the last 12 months. It primarily invests in Seed round in Indonesia based startups. Its investments are spread across a wide range of sectors from Enterprise Applications to Consumer and Retail. 1. Mercari
Online marketplace platform for used multi-category products. The platform allows users to buy and sell products from different categories like fashion, beauty, sports, electronics, books, pet supplies, art supplies, home decor, office supplies, and more. The mobile application is available for Android and iOS users.

2. Traveloka
Online retailer of worldwide flights, hotels, activities, and travel deals. It provides a platform for booking accommodations, transportation, and various activities. The platform offers options for flights, hotel stays, car rentals, and airport transfers. It also features travel articles and information.

3. Xendit
Online payment and money transfer platform for businesses. The company serves commerce startups to large enterprises enabling businesses to accept payments, disburse payroll, run marketplaces, and more. Payments can be accepted via multiple channels including direct debit, virtual accounts, credit and debit cards, e-wallets, retail outlets, online installments, and more. Application is made available on Android and iOS platforms.
